This Imperial Stout is aged on cacao nibs and dried peppermint leaves, creating a rich, decadent after-dinner or dessert beer.

Draught @ Mikkeller Beer Celebration Copenhagen 2017 - Red Session
Pours black with a tan head. Aroma has notes of roasted malt, chocolate, peppermint, after eight, coffee and caramel. Taste is medium sweet and medium bitter with a long peppermint, chocolate, coffee and caramel finish. Body is full, texture is oily, carbonation is soft.

750 ml from the Hwy 2 road trip. Aroma is mint, chocolate, licorice. Pours like motor oil, very black with a nice dark tan head with great retention. Taste is sweet, somewhat bitter in the finish. Lots of mint and chocolate in flavor, licorice too. Very rich. Syrupy texture. Definitely a bottle to share. I wouldn't want to finish this on my own.
